About Our Handwriting Practice Worksheets

Our handwriting practice worksheets help students in Grades PreK-3 develop neat, legible print handwriting with proper letter formation and spacing. Every worksheet includes a complete answer key for quick feedback.

What Students Will Learn

Students practice manuscript (print) handwriting with a focus on proper letter formation, consistent sizing, spacing between letters and words, and line placement. The worksheets progress from tracing to copying to independent writing, covering both u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and simple sentences.

How Parents and Homeschoolers Can Use These Worksheets

Focus on one or two letters per session rather than the whole alphabet. Use the "my turn, your turn" method: you write a letter, then your child writes it. Correct pencil grip early — the tripod grip (thumb, index, and middle finger) prevents fatigue. Praise specific improvements: "Your lowercase 'g' tail curves beautifully below the line!"
